Joseph Gilbert Dies After Losing Control of Truck


Joseph Gilbert

The driver of a box truck died on Wednesday after he lost control of his vehicle and slammed into a tree.

The crash occurred shortly after noon on Riverside Parkway at Factory Shoals Road in Austell.

Cobb police identified the deceased driver as Joseph T. Gilbert, 47, of Hiram.

Investigators said Gilbert was driving a 2013 International 4300 box truck and going east on Riverside Parkway when he lost control of the vehicle.

Police spokesman Sgt. Wayne Delk said the driver crashed into two street signs in the median. The truck then went off the right side of the roadway and hurtled through the fence in front of the Azure at Riverside Apartments.

The truck subsequently hit a large tree in front of the apartment building. 

Gilbert died at the scene.

No other vehicles were involved in the crash and there were no reports of other injuries. The authorities did not indicate what could have caused Gilbert to lose control of the truck.

Investigations into the crash caused traffic to back up on Riverside Parkway during the lunchtime drive.

This was one of two crashes that had the attention of Cobb police on Wednesday.

Almost two hours after this fatal accident in south Cobb, the authorities were called to one in north Cobb involving a motorcycle and a car.

That accident resulted in serious injuries to motorcyclist Errol Simms of Acworth. He was thrown from his bike. The other driver, Ludene Harris did not suffer serious injuries.

Both crashes remain under investigation. Anyone with information is asked to call 770-499-3987.
